About The Role
The Inpatient Psych Social Worker at Sinai Hospital acts as a coordinator of psychosocial assessment and discharge planning for the patients/clients receiving inpatient psychiatric services at Hospital, providing leadership and psychosocial support necessary to address the individual's needs.
This is a Part-Time position that will be scheduled for 2 Day shifts during the week M - F with no weekend shifts.*
Key Responsibilities
Assessment & Planning: Conducts initial and ongoing assessments to determine patient needs for care coordination and discharge, then develops a focused discharge plan, especially for high-risk patients. Intervention & Collaboration: Works closely with the clinical team and medical providers to put the discharge plan into action. Continuous Improvement: Stays current with healthcare trends, regulations, and payer requirements related to patient care, discharge planning, and benefits.
Requirements
Seasoned professional knowledge; equivalent to a Master's degree; knowledge in more than one discipline. Master's in Social Work required. 3-5 years related experience; Prior experience with Behavioral Health case management/discharge planning strongly preferred Current Maryland LMSW, LCSW, LCSW-C or LCPC required MD Social Work License per level of education. Expectation is to participate in a unit or departmental work groups and meetings whereby initiatives and leadership skills are to be exhibited. May supervise an MSW intern as a field instructor.
